Holbrook-Marsh

Kelly Nicole Holbrook and Trenton J. Marsh were married July 28, 2007, at Pierceton United Methodist Church with Pastor Duane Kline officiating. The bride is the daughter of Stephen and Debra Holbrook, Warsaw; the groom's parents are Christopher and Twyla Mabie, Albion.

Maids of honor were Tiffany Rinker, Alexandria, and Megan Baltz, Shorewood, Ill. Bridesmaids were Becky Welker, Frankton; Erin Sampson, Warsaw; Heidi Holbrook, Granger. Flower girl was Carly Mabie, Albion.

Best man was Craig Jones, Elkhart. Groomsmen were Jake Huffman and Ethan Marsh, both of Columbia City; Ryan Holbrook, Warsaw; and Chad Holbrook, Granger. Ushers were Dusty McNab, Carmel, and Matt Spiess, Corunna.

A reception was held at Eagle's Nest Event Center, Columbia City.

The bride is a special education teacher at Syracuse Elementary School, Syracuse. The bride is a 2001 graduate of Warsaw Community High School, Warsaw. She is a graduate of Manchester College in 2005 with an early/middle childhood generalist with mild intervention certification.

The groom is an employee of Dick's Sporting Goods, Fort Wayne. He is a 2001 graduate of Columbia City High School. He earned a degree in business management from Manchester College in 2006.

After a wedding trip to Las Vegas, Nev., the couple reside in Albion.
